Tashkent, Uzbekistan (UzDaily.com) -- On 20 March 2021, the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Uzbekistan Abdulaziz Kamilov had a telephone conversation with the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Islamic Republic of Afghanistan Hanif Atmar.
At the beginning of the conversation, the heads of the foreign ministries exchanged sincere congratulations and warm wishes in connection with the traditional spring holiday of the awakening and renewal of nature - Navruz.
The ministers discussed the state and prospects of Uzbek-Afghan relations in the political, trade, economic, investment, cultural, humanitarian and other spheres.
Particular attention wass paid to the implementation of transport, communication, energy and other infrastructure projects, in particular, the construction of the Surkhan-Puli-Khumri power line and the Mazar-i-Sharif-Kabul-Peshawar railway.
The parties reviewed and agreed on a plan for upcoming bilateral events.
During the conversation, an exchange of views took place on the issues of the joint agenda.
